1 /*
2 * relocate - common relocation function for ARM U-Boot
3 *
4 * Copyright (c) 2013 Albert ARIBAUD <albert.u.boot@aribaud.net>
5 *
6 * SPDX-License-Identifier: GPL-2.0+
7 */
8
9 #include <asm-offsets.h>
10 #include <config.h>
11 #include <linux/linkage.h>
12
13 /*
14 * void relocate_code(addr_moni)
15 *
16 * This function relocates the monitor code.
17 *
18 * NOTE:
19 * To prevent the code below from containing references with an R_ARM_ABS32
20 * relocation record type, we never refer to linker-defined symbols directly.
21 * Instead, we declare literals which contain their relative location with
22 * respect to relocate_code, and at run time, add relocate_code back to them.
23 */
24
25 ENTRY(relocate_code)
26 ldr r1, =__image_copy_start /* r1 <- SRC &__image_copy_start */
27 subs r4, r0, r1 /* r4 <- relocation offset */
28 beq relocate_done /* skip relocation */
29 ldr r2, =__image_copy_end /* r2 <- SRC &__image_copy_end */
30
31 copy_loop:
32 ldmia r1!, {r10-r11} /* copy from source address [r1] */
33 stmia r0!, {r10-r11} /* copy to target address [r0] */
34 cmp r1, r2 /* until source end address [r2] */
35 blo copy_loop
36
37 /*
38 * fix .rel.dyn relocations
39 */
40 ldr r2, =__rel_dyn_start /* r2 <- SRC &__rel_dyn_start */
41 ldr r3, =__rel_dyn_end /* r3 <- SRC &__rel_dyn_end */
42 fixloop:
43 ldmia r2!, {r0-r1} /* (r0,r1) <- (SRC location,fixup) */
44 and r1, r1, #0xff
45 cmp r1, #23 /* relative fixup? */
46 bne fixnext
47
48 /* relative fix: increase location by offset */
49 add r0, r0, r4
50 ldr r1, [r0]
51 add r1, r1, r4
52 str r1, [r0]
53 fixnext:
54 cmp r2, r3
55 blo fixloop
56
57 /*
58 * Relocate the exception vectors
59 */
60 #ifdef CONFIG_HAS_VBAR
61 /*
62 * If the ARM processor has the security extensions,
63 * use VBAR to relocate the exception vectors.
64 */
65 ldr r0, [r9, #GD_RELOCADDR] /* r0 = gd->relocaddr */
66 mcr p15, 0, r0, c12, c0, 0 /* Set VBAR */
67 #else
68 /*
69 * Copy the relocated exception vectors to the
70 * correct address
71 * CP15 c1 V bit gives us the location of the vectors:
72 * 0x00000000 or 0xFFFF0000.
73 */
74 ldr r0, [r9, #GD_RELOCADDR] /* r0 = gd->relocaddr */
75 mrc p15, 0, r2, c1, c0, 0 /* V bit (bit[13]) in CP15 c1 */
76 ands r2, r2, #(1 << 13)
77 ldreq r1, =0x00000000 /* If V=0 */
78 ldrne r1, =0xFFFF0000 /* If V=1 */
79 ldmia r0!, {r2-r8,r10}
80 stmia r1!, {r2-r8,r10}
81 ldmia r0!, {r2-r8,r10}
82 stmia r1!, {r2-r8,r10}
83 #endif
84
85 relocate_done:
86
87 #ifdef __XSCALE__
88 /*
89 * On xscale, icache must be invalidated and write buffers drained,
90 * even with cache disabled - 4.2.7 of xscale core developer's manual
91 */
92 mcr p15, 0, r0, c7, c7, 0 /* invalidate icache */
93 mcr p15, 0, r0, c7, c10, 4 /* drain write buffer */
94 #endif
95
96 /* ARMv4- don't know bx lr but the assembler fails to see that */
97
98 #ifdef __ARM_ARCH_4__
99 mov pc, lr
100 #else
101 bx lr
102 #endif
103
104 ENDPROC(relocate_code)
